The practice was as follows: a long column was erected first (the length varied from the actual conditions of bridge), and the tail of the near fir is firmly fixed with a long column using flax rope or thin bamboo strips, and then the swing is fixed by connecting the lower part to the ground; after the two swing pillars in front of the abutment are fixed, a wooden beam is connected with the upper part so as to form the shape of "swing framework", which is provided for carpenters to go up and down and also support all wood materials in the "tri-segment arch" and the "five-segment arch".
In this part, tri-segment arch system and five-segment arch system realize a mutual occlusion and integrate into a whole body, so as to commonly carry the key of the load.
The materials of the up and down inclined blades in the five-segment arch system were relatively small and also different in length.
The materials used in the plain wood of tri-segment arch and five-segment arch were great, and also the head and tail of wood materials were overlapped.
